Imagine Douglas Adams' and Terry Pratchett's illegitimate American
son re-telling Dante's Divine Comedy on the set of The Office, and
you will only begin to appreciate the torturous hilarity of this
new book by Doug Newman. Follow the eternal damnation of Hugh
Kroked, a soul condemned to his own corporate version of Hell.
Although his lively sins were unremarkable, Kroked must endure
torture and punishment in even the most menial tasks set before him
by the upper echelons of Demonhood, all while navigating a
labyrinth of hellish colleagues and apocalyptic consequences.
Hellhounds trail behind Kroked as Hell's Bells toll ever faster,
threatening to rend the very fabric of the afterlife. Will Hugh
choose the right path in the dark, or will his simple presentation
slides bring the unwanted attentions of Ba'al Zebub himself?
